CSS3 中可以通过属性选择器轻松地为 input 元素添加样式。如果您想为输入框添加特定的背景颜色,可以使用如下代码:input { backgroundcolor: F7F7F7; } 如果您想添...
CSS3 中可以通过属性选择器轻松地为 input 元素添加样式。如果您想为输入框添加特定的背景颜色,可以使用如下代码:
input[type="text"] {
background-color: #F7F7F7;
} 如果您想添加特定的外边框,可以使用如下代码:
input[type="text"] {
border: 1px solid #CCC;
} 除此之外,您还可以通过伪类选择器来为输入框添加特殊的效果。比如当输入框获得焦点时添加边框阴影:
input[type="text"]:focus {
box-shadow: 0 0 5px #9B9B9B;
} 或者当用户开始输入时改变输入框的背景色:
input[type="text"]:focus, input[type="text"]:valid {
background-color: #E6FFE6;
} 在 CSS3 中,您还可以使用 ::placeholder 伪元素为输入框中的提示文本添加样式:
input[type="text"]::placeholder {
color: #AAA;
font-size: 14px;
} 通过以上代码示例,您可以快速了解如何使用 CSS3 为输入框添加样式。您可以根据实际需求,进一步探索 CSS3 的属性选择器和伪类选择器。希望本文能够对您有所帮助。